phwoar
English
Etymology
Imitative of the sound made, with the mouth initially partly closed and then opened wide.
Pronunciation
- (UK) IPA(key): /fwɔː(ɹ)/
- Rhymes: -ɔː(r)
Interjection
phwoar
- (Britain, slang) Expresses sexual desire on seeing a person that one is attracted to.
- That Susan, phwoar!

Verb
phwoar (third-person singular simple present phwoars, present participle phwoaring, simple past and past participle phwoared)
- To express sexual desire upon seeing a person that one finds sexually attractive.
